This will be the last Friday Focus for the school year, so I'll try to remember to have everything you need to know to get through the last week of classes. Please remember contracts are due to Central Office on the 23rd. I do have a basket on my desk where you can turn it into me and I'll get it to Central Office.
We will be running the advisory schedule on Monday. On Tuesday, we will use the last day of school schedule. On the last day of classes students will be checking out. Please sign their check out sheets. If they have school property that needs to be returned, please document it on the sheet. During advisory that day, they will turn in their laptops. Please look at each laptop and make them turn it on for you. If there is any damage, send them to the office with the computer. We will determine if they will need to pay for damages. This includes broken screens, missing keys from the keyboard, cracked cases, etc. On the sheet, please indicate if their computer and charger are turned in. If they are missing a charger, please document that on the sheet and send them to the office so they can pay for a replacement.
Semester tests on Wed-Friday will operate like normal. Students will need to remain in the classroom the entire testing time. They can not leave early to go to another room or to leave the building. A student may move a test if it benefits you, otherwise they need to take it when they are scheduled. Remember, they can't leave another class early to come to your room to take a test. We don't want them to hurry through a test to get to another one. Final grades will be due before you check out on the 27th.
On the 27th, Mr. Moss and I will beginning check out at noon. Please make sure you have your room ready for summer maintenance, have anything breakable put away, and anything you don't want in the hallway when your room is cleaned in your storage closet. I will also share with you a textbook inventory spreadsheet I will need you to complete for each class or textbook.
